このページは Cloud Translation API によって翻訳されました。
Switch to English

tensorflow :: ops :: ParameterizedTruncatedNormal

#include <random_ops.h>

正規分布からランダムな値を出力します。

概要

パラメータはそれぞれ

出力全体に適用されるスカラー、または各バッチのパラメーターを格納する長さshape [0]のベクトル。

引数:

  • scope: Scopeオブジェクト
  • shape:出力テンソルの形状。バッチは、0番目の次元で索引付けされます。
  • 平均:各バッチの平均パラメーター。
  • stdevs:各バッチの標準偏差パラメーター。 0より大きくなければなりません。
  • minvals:最小カットオフ。無限かもしれません。
  • maxvals:最大カットオフ。 +無限大の可能性があり、各バッチのminvalより大きくなければなりません。

オプションの属性( Attrs参照):

  • 種子:いずれかの場合seed又はseed2非ゼロに設定されている、乱数発生器は、所与の種によって播種されます。それ以外の場合は、ランダムシードによってシードされます。
  • seed2:シードの衝突を回避するための2番目のシード。

戻り値:

  • Output :各行のパラメーターを使用してランダムに切り捨てられた正規値で満たされた、形状num_batches x samples_per_batchの行列。

コンストラクタとデストラクタ

ParameterizedTruncatedNormal (const :: tensorflow::Scope & scope, :: tensorflow::Input shape, :: tensorflow::Input means, :: tensorflow::Input stdevs, :: tensorflow::Input minvals, :: tensorflow::Input maxvals)
ParameterizedTruncatedNormal (const :: tensorflow::Scope & scope, :: tensorflow::Input shape, :: tensorflow::Input means, :: tensorflow::Input stdevs, :: tensorflow::Input minvals, :: tensorflow::Input maxvals, const ParameterizedTruncatedNormal::Attrs & attrs)

公開属性

operation
output

公開機能

node () const
::tensorflow::Node *
operator::tensorflow::Input () const
operator::tensorflow::Output () const

パブリック静的関数

Seed (int64 x)
Seed2 (int64 x)

構造

tensorflow :: ops :: ParameterizedTruncatedNormal :: Attrs

ParameterizedTruncatedNormalのオプションの属性セッター。

公開属性

操作

Operation operation

出力

::tensorflow::Output output

公開機能

ParameterizedTruncatedNormal

 ParameterizedTruncatedNormal(
  const ::tensorflow::Scope & scope,
  ::tensorflow::Input shape,
  ::tensorflow::Input means,
  ::tensorflow::Input stdevs,
  ::tensorflow::Input minvals,
  ::tensorflow::Input maxvals
)

ParameterizedTruncatedNormal

 ParameterizedTruncatedNormal(
  const ::tensorflow::Scope & scope,
  ::tensorflow::Input shape,
  ::tensorflow::Input means,
  ::tensorflow::Input stdevs,
  ::tensorflow::Input minvals,
  ::tensorflow::Input maxvals,
  const ParameterizedTruncatedNormal::Attrs & attrs
)

ノード

::tensorflow::Node * node() const 

operator :: tensorflow :: Input

 operator::tensorflow::Input() const 

operator :: tensorflow :: Output

 operator::tensorflow::Output() const 

パブリック静的関数

シード

Attrs Seed(
  int64 x
)

シード2

Attrs Seed2(
  int64 x
)